Dog in Tagalog

“Dog” in Tagalog is “Aso” – the most common term for our loyal four-legged companions in Filipino language. Whether you’re talking about pets, strays, or working dogs, “aso” is the word you’ll hear everywhere in the Philippines. Let’s explore more ways to express this and see it in action!

[Words] = Dog

[Definition]:

  • Dog /dɔːɡ/
  • Noun: A domesticated carnivorous mammal that typically has a long snout, an acute sense of smell, non-retractable claws, and a barking, howling, or whining voice.
  • Noun: A person regarded as unpleasant, contemptible, or wicked (informal).
  • Verb: To follow someone persistently or closely.
